RadioLogger is the number one solution for recording and archiving your radio broadcasts. Keeping an archive of the more recent broadcasts can come in useful in a number of situations. For example, if you need to prove to a company that the advertising tracks that they have commissioned are being played at the correct times and frequencies, a radio archive can provide this proof. The software does not take up much in the way of system resources either and it can be left running unattended for as long as you need it. Older records can automatically be deleted as well to save more space on your hard disk. Recording can be done directly from the playback device and compressed into the format which you specify. Compression is done on-the-fly in order to save system resources and use less disk space. The software also logs a complete history of all of the archives made.
